SYDNEY, Nov. 5,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— Miroma Challenge Manufacturing facility (MPF) has re-launched an up to date and re-designed model of Avow, Australia’s first digital device designed particularly to help people who use violence, serving to them perceive Apprehended Home Violence Orders (ADVOs), replicate on their behaviour, and take steps to keep away from reoffending.

Miroma Project Factory’s Avow App Leads the Way in Tech-Driven Domestic Violence Prevention
Miroma Challenge Manufacturing facility’s Avow app, redesigned to help people in understanding ADVO situations and interesting with behaviour change instruments for home violence prevention.

The Avow app, developed in partnership with the NSW Division of Communities and Justice (DCJ), was in-built response to a stark actuality: greater than a 3rd of ADVO breaches happen inside the first month of the order being issued. With lengthy wait occasions and restricted availability for behaviour change applications and low early engagement with help providers, many perpetrators lack data and instruments for reflection or readability within the vital moments following  preliminary police or court docket contact.

“The Avow app places data perpetrators must adjust to their ADVO at their fingertips”. “It’s accessible anytime, wherever, at no cost, that means perpetrators can extra simply tackle their behaviour.”mentioned Mr Speakman in 2021 as then Minister for Prevention of Home and Sexual Violence

First launched in 2021 and absolutely redesigned in 2024 to optimise the person expertise, Avow gives a private, non-judgemental digital house the place customers can entry plain English data to grasp their authorized situations and the court docket course of, entry help, set private objectives, and develop methods utilizing strategies grounded in evidence-based behavioural science that goal to cut back their danger of reoffending and in the end enhance sufferer security.

Its current redevelopment into Flutter has modernised the person expertise into one thing inclusive, accessible and optimised for scale. What was initially a static, male-oriented device is now a dynamic, gender-neutral platform centered on engagement and affect.

MPF led the redesign and technical construct, delivering:

  • Chat-driven onboarding
  • Purpose setting and affirmation options
  • Court docket appointment reminders and ADVO situation overview
  • Self-paced behaviour change planning
  • Motion plans linked to emotional triggers and customary ADVO breach dangers
  • Updated help content material for self-referral, reflection and authorized literacy

“Avow is proof that we are able to meet individuals at their most risky and aggravating moments with a digital answer that helps them select a distinct path and make higher selections,” mentioned Lynette Reeves, Behaviour Change Specialist for MPF and Program Lead for Avow.  “We constructed this app to be a quiet however highly effective intervention that customers can use anytime, wherever. And now, nationwide coverage is lastly catching up.”

Certainly, the 2024 Speedy Evaluate of Prevention Approaches, commissioned by the Commonwealth, explicitly known as for early, technology-enabled interventions that promote self-reflection and accountability. Avow, which has been delivering precisely that since 2018, was not too long ago highlighted for instance of what the sector wants extra of: scalable, low-barrier, trauma-informed instruments for individuals who use violence.

Avow has been downloaded over 2,000 occasions, with a 39% returning person fee and robust engagement throughout key options akin to “My ADVO”, “Court docket Data”, and “My Motion Plan”. Frontline employees report that shoppers who use Avow present improved understanding of their situations, higher openness to therapeutic referrals, and discount in impulsive, breach-prone behaviour.

As state and federal governments look to fund the subsequent wave of home violence prevention options, Avow is uniquely positioned – validated by frontline uptake, prepared for jurisdictional localisation, and aligned with nationwide prevention methods. The Avow staff welcomes alternatives for neighborhood engagement and partnerships to proceed this work into the long run.

About Avow

Avow is a behaviour change app designed to help home violence perpetrators higher  perceive and adjust to their Apprehended Home Violence Orders (ADVOs). Developed by Miroma Challenge Manufacturing facility in partnership with the NSW Division of Communities and Justice, Avow delivers authorized literacy, danger planning, and reflective instruments in a personal, digital format. It is likely one of the solely Australian instruments focusing on perpetrators instantly, serving to scale back early-stage breaches and promote safer decisions. Avow has been in use since 2021 and is now present process additional growth to align with nationwide prevention priorities.

Avow is promoted to customers by the NSW Division of Communities and Justice, NSW police, native courts, solicitors and help companies.
